Output 85b290d2ae655669e83daf569bcaff976709f7d0f96e3154283af8a6ce3e3990:69

value
87669700
script pubkey
OP_0 OP_PUSHBYTES_20 1acf24c745f2589b35109feb9f1bed53be2201e3
address
bc1qrt8jf3697fvfkdgsnl4e7xld2wlzyq0rwavrgt
transaction
85b290d2ae655669e83daf569bcaff976709f7d0f96e3154283af8a6ce3e3990
spent
true